WebNov 19, 2024 · But divorce in and of itself doesn’t change the commitment you and your spouse made to your mortgage. If both individuals applied for the mortgage, then both of you are still responsible for the monthly payments. But when a couple splits up and there’s a mortgage, you have a few options. To retain ownership of the home solo, you’ll typically need to first buy out your ex-spouse, says Jenkins. If you have $50,000 in equity in your current home and you’ve agreed to a 50-50 split of its value, you’ll need to come up with $25,000 to buy out your former spouse, Jenkins says.
